Transaction 8e4bca9dd57977c6a28366a01325ea091972f18a03abc5c3a32c51ed9727c54f
1 Input
1 Output
-
8e4bca9dd57977c6a28366a01325ea091972f18a03abc5c3a32c51ed9727c54f:0
- value
- 780606177
- script pubkey
- OP_0 OP_PUSHBYTES_20 69cf08ea87e341fff2a9515735e28a8ea3e09fc9
- address
- bc1qd88s3658udqllu4f29tntc523637p87fdq5gak